2016 is the year in which Scotland’s achievements in innovation, architecture, and design will be showcased and celebrated with a programme of activities aimed at helping to raise the international profile of the country’s important industries and help grow our tourism and events sector. From cutting-edge technology to textiles, architecture and craft, Scotland boasts an outstanding heritage and contemporary practice which continues to inspire audiences across the globe.
